Bollywood movies and their unrealistic clichés

People enter situations with expectations based on their own personal opinions, ideals, and aspirations as well as more subliminal expectations based on hidden insecurities and flaws. All of these are quite subjective and personal.

Bollywood is renowned for producing content that occasionally departs greatly from reality. The notion that it is simple for a boy to meet a girl, for the two of them to fall in love, to get beyond a hurdle, and to live happily ever after is what makes the audience believe these expectations. The Bollywood movies I watched as a child made everything in the future appear like it would be simple. Even if we secretly desire we may one day discover a romance as stunning as the lovers on our televisions, we frequently scoff and mock at how corny these images of romances are. It’s like these movies are escorting us to a perfect utopia where a background music score is what makes us feel alive. And undoubtedly, there are songs for even the slightest of these details in Bollywood.

Wondering what your heart is feeling? There is a song for it. It is your friend’s wedding, but you are the center of attention. There is a song for it. A lover describing his beloved’s eyes, there are a great deal of songs for this in Bollywood too. Most rom-com movies contain a small amount of fantasy, whether we’re aware of it or not. However, there are times when you can’t help but question whether it’s not too much. Especially when it comes to underlying expectations of youth love. It’s shocking how a guy’s vigorous attempt at persuasion leads the girl to fall in love with him, even after rejecting him for the hundredth time.

Bollywood films tend to use such love stories to draw in more viewers. Even we, unconsciously, fall for it. Moreover, this industry is very capable of producing strategic films. And just like that, Bollywood is figuring its way into contemporary films featuring youth defying social conventions, especially in this on-going modern generation. In general, it’s critical for those individuals who are into these concepts to comprehend the crucial gap between the romantic love we see in movies and the irrational expectations they foster.

Rom-coms are entertaining, but that contrast needs to be seen in the eyes of the audience.
